A great way to green up your travels is to make your own travel toiletries before you hit the road. Hotels waste a lot of resources on those mini shampoos, soaps, lotions, and other misc. bathroom items. Each time someone uses one of them and doesn't take it with them, the hotel is forced to throw it out. Making your own travel toiletries is easier than you might think. Once you have all of your toiletries in place, don't rush out just yet to get a toiletries bag.

It's important that your bag for your toiletries is waterproof and zips shut. Without these two important features in place, your bathroom goodies could spill out onto everything else. Believe me, that's a sure way to ruin a day.

A common item that works perfectly for travel toiletries: plastic bags, with a zipper, that enclose sheets and other linens. When you buy new linens, they are usually in one of these bags.
